"In our study we are stressing the social function of land-art as a kind of protest going far beyond the professional land-art work and taking the form of bottom-up social movements. We have labelled this process Land, Society and Art - LSA. LSA is often a free, spontaneous movement against the losing of a memory of a place. The aim of LSA is to create common society symbols in the landscape; professional land-art installation is not the main purpose. A common issue with land-art is the element of protest. Protest against commodification of the art, protest against isolation of the art and nature, but, from the sociological point of view, the main issue is the underlying protest against the consequences of the modernisation process; against the 'demagification' (demystification, disenchantment) of the world, according to Weber's interpretation. Our aim is to show the differences and common issues between traditional land-art and the LSA using cases in The Czech Republic - Vod\u0148any in 2012, Konigsm\u0171hle - both created in 2012, as well some conceptual generalisation.
